I'm not sure exactly what you have to work with and what you want to do. I
don't have an MC-60 but did some searching for information on it. Seems one
kind has the microphone hard wired to the base, so it doesn't seem like that
one would work easily with a boom. Another variation says you can use the
microphone with out the base, just use the coiled cord as an extension for
the microphone cable on the mic. If you search for "8 pin microphone
extension" you will find many products available, both coiled and straight
cords.

Good Afternoon, my name is Mark Griffin and my call is KB3Z. I have used a 
Kenwood MC-60 microphone ever since I purchased my K3 four years ago. I would 
like to connect the microphone to a boom assembly, but trying to find a 
microphone cable that would be long enough to connect to the K3 and then to the 
front of the boom might be difficult. I tried Heil, but Jerry Lynch gave me no 
help whatsoever. Does anyone know of a manufacturer who makes microphone 
cables? Thanks!! Mark KB3Z
